This review is for Kampung Malay Restaurant, Bundall QLD

verified email - 14 Jan 2014

Whether you dine in or take away this restaurant always delivers.
My favourite is their curry duck as I know this is gluten free.
Staff are very informative on the meals, always helpful and friendly.
Its a BYO but they also serve soft drinks.
Everything is cooked on the premises and you very rarely have to wait long.
Can get busy on Fridays and Saturdays so you have to book a table then but mid-week its quite easy to get a table.
We sometimes have lunch here mainly because they do lunch time specials with curries around $10.
Try their sweet and sour pork the kids say 'its to die for'.

Approximate cost: $13-$17

This review is for Singh's Restaurant, Corinda QLD

verified email - 12 Jan 2014

This restaurant is a little gem.
I explained that I was Gluten intolerant and they couldn't have been more helpful promising me that all their meals were gluten free.
When the chef/owner heard we were originally from the UK he came out and chatted to us which was lovely. He also asked how we liked our curries so that he could prepare them to our tastes as we said we were use to hot curries.
There were 6 of us to dinner and we found that there was plenty of food to good around.
I highly recommend the Lamb Saag and the Butter Chicken absolutely delicious.
What I really like is that everything is cooked from scratch with the use of proper spices and the right amount of chillies.
We have also had take away from them on many occasions and every time we were delighted with our meals.

Approximate cost: $20

This review is for Le Porte Verte, Robina QLD

verified email - 11 Jan 2014

Only place on the coast where I have found authentic Escargot which I love. Just the right amount of garlic for me.
The food here is excellent, very french and well presented.
My favourite's are the mussels and their chicken dishes.
Sauces are perfect. Very creamy with the right amount of seasoning.
Hubby likes their steaks best especially the steak au poivre. He says the pepper sauce that comes with it is nearly as good as mine. (Flatterer)
Last time we went we shared a Creme Brulee next time he gets his own.
They have a decent selection of wines too.
Staff are friendly and polite.
The prices here are not cheap but its worth a visit.

Approximate cost: $30
